 The current continues in the same direction while the voltage or tension changes sign. The current can't be stopped or having its direction changed in a jump as it is always continuous. It would be like immediately stopping or changing the direction of a running flywheel. The force required or given off is like the voltage when speaking coils. The voltage or force will be of infinite size if the change happens in an instant. The current starts decreasing from whatever value it has at the disruption. Only how fast is related to the size of the induced voltage (u = L x di/dt) where u is the voltage, L is the inductance of the coil, i is the current and t is time. di/dt is the slope of the current.
